Chandula Large Image

Chandula Abeywickrema

Chairman

Chandula Abeywickrema is well-respected commercial banker with impeccable banking and finance career and tract record of over 30 years in Sri Lanka and in Asia. He started his banking and finance career in 1983 from Lanka Orix Leasing Plc (LOLC) as a senior credit analyst, headed the Hatton National Bank (HNB) retail and development banking as the Deputy General Manager, very successfully for 25 yeas. He spearheaded the HNB’s retail and development banking strategy over two decades enabling the bank to achieve national and international accolades. Under his leadership HNB won the best retail bank award for six consecutive years. He currently serves in the National Savings Bank (NSB) third largest public sector bank in Sri Lanka as the Consultant –Strategy and Marketing.

Chandula is an international expert in micro-finance and financial inclusion and is the Chairman of the board of Banking With the Poor Network (BWTP) which is the largest microfinance network in Asia. He also serves as the special advisor on Financial Inclusion to Asian Bankers Association, the largest Asian banks network. He currently serves as the board Chairman of the Vision Fund Sri Lanka(VFL) which microfinance subsidiary of the World Vision and Chairman of Lanka Financial Services Underserved Settlements (LFSUS) a UN incorporated body in Sri Lanka for law income housing. When the first ever national apex body was created in Sri Lank in 2013 as an initiative of USAID, representing the private corporate sector Chandula was invited to give the leadership corporate sustainability strategy in Sri Lanka, and currently leads the CSR SRI Lanka as the Chairman. In addition with a great passion and commitment to greater financial inclusion in Asia, Chandula serves on numerous boards of banking and finance institution in Asia and in Sri Lanka.

Eranda Large Image

Eranda Ginige

Director

Eranda is the founder of Social Enterprise Lanka, a pioneering initiative to develop the social enterprise sector in Sri Lanka. He was the former Head of Innovation, Partnerships and Business Development at the British Council in Sri Lanka. He holds a Master’s degree in Project Management specialising in Business Administration from the University of Southern Queensland Australia. Eranda is a pioneer in developing graduate entrepreneurship in Sri Lanka. He has developed a number of programmes such as the popular enterprise reality TV show IDEATORS and has developed many institutional partnerships between the public, private and development sector organisations.

Travis Large Image

Travis Waas

Travis, counts more than 25 years of experience in the financial services sector, having commenced his career at Lanka Orix Leasing Company Ltd in 1987. After serving Hatton National Bank Ltd and Vanik Incorporation Ltd where he set up their respective Leasing Divisions, he joined DPMC Financial Services Ltd in 1999 as its Executive Director to steer the financial services cluster of the David Pieris Group. He was the founder Managing Director of Assetline Leasing Company Ltd from 2003 – 2009 and Director / CEO of Orient Financial Services Corporation Ltd till 2012. In November 2013, he was appointed as a Non-Executive Director at Capital Alliance Finance PLC. and served as its Chairman prior to its acquisition by Cargills Bank Ltd. Currently, he serves as a Director of Lanka Financial Services for Underserved Settlements, a company set up by UN-habitat in partnership with the Government of Sri Lanka to cater to the housing needs of the marginalized.

He is the holder of a B.Sc. from the University of Colombo and a MBA from University of North Texas (UNT), USA.
